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ES The Essential Duties and Responsibilities are intended to present a descriptive list of the range of duties performed for this position, and are not intended to reflect all duties performed within the job. Other duties may be assigned. Observe and report activities and incidents at assigned locations, providing for the security and safety of client property, visitors, and personnel. Preserve order and may act to enforce regulations and directives for the site pertaining to personnel, visitors, and premises; Control access to client site and facility through the admittance process; Be responsive in all situations; Monitor entrances and exits and act to prevent unapproved OR unlawful entry; Patrol assigned site, check for unsafe conditions such as hazards, unlocked doors, and security violations; Protect evidence OR scenes of incident in the event of accidents, emergencies, OR security investigations; Prepare logs OR reports as requested. Required (Minimum) Qualifications US citizen OR Lawful Resident who is a current member of OR has an honorable discharge from the US armed forces and must have a social security card. Received a High School diploma, OR received a GED, OR shows HS graduation / equivalent education on a DD-214, OR completion of 60 credit hours in related field from learning institution recognized by Dept. of Education, OR successfully graduated from a federal / state certified law enforcement education / training course that may result in a LE appointment OR commission. Have a minimum of two years of Security / LE experience OR 2 years of Honorable service with the US Armed Forces. Be a minimum of 21 years of age; fluent in speaking, reading, comprehending and writing English due to nature of the position. A “Standardized Literacy Test” which measures and individual’s written and verbal understanding of the English language must be administered prior to employment.
